Reading this, I'm realising how lucky my dad is. Last week Wednesday, got shocked awake by a loud weird noise that sounded like an animal getting mauled and the my mother shouting for my help only to find my father in full seizure and struggling to breath. Managed to get the seizure and his breathing under control by the time the ambulance arrived. When the paramedics arrived and checked him, his blood pressure was 238/119. What it was at the the time of the seizure, I can only guess. He's been in hospital since last week and his bp only dropped below 200 yesterday. Funny thing is, he says that he feels totally fine - no headaches, no dizzyness, no shortness of breath and no other aches or pains at all.i've beaten that one by a long stretch - managed 220/140.

for the most part, it is better to bring bp back down slowly, bp is probably being reduced slowly and steadily using iv meds.He's been in hospital since last week and his bp only dropped below 200 yesterday.
How is yours now?for the most part, it is better to bring bp back down slowly, bp is probably being reduced slowly and steadily using iv meds.
a sudden drop of 25% + can very quickly lead to a stroke or organ damage.
